TICKET: Scanline-4412 — config drift on barcode scanner bridge. The Pekkra warehouse nodes are running stale settings for the ZentoScan integration; three scanners in Bay 7 fall back to legacy checksum mode. Root cause: manual edits during last month's firmware patch never landed in the repo. Impact: intermittent mis-reads on pallet intake, roughly 2% of scans. Fix: re-baseline all nodes from source control, then lock the config path. Owner: Dravik, target this sprint. Current live values on the affected nodes are as follows.

deployment values, yadug-bawif:
[framir]
team = pelox
access_code = ac_a38ab2
owner = tamion.julael
host = framir.tolvaqlabs.test
port = 11211
peer = tammir.zemvargrid.local
salt = 2215ef03
pin = 1541

Hi all, especially our newcomers! Friday we're drilling disaster recovery on Tallowgrid's GraphQL gateway. Backstory: our recent N+1 query fix added a batching layer, and we need to prove the gateway restores cleanly with batching intact. We'll kill the resolver cache, fail over to the standby region, and watch query counts like hawks. Don't stress if latency graphs look scary — that's expected mid-drill. Grab the runbook from the wiki first. The failover console unlocks with the passphrase right below this line.

vault phrase of bagaf-kajeg = jorath-feniel-briir-siliel-ralix

Handover note — Night-shift access, Support Team

Hi Aldin,

Since you're taking over the night rota at Quenby Tower, here's what you need to know. The support team works from the second-floor hub between 22:00 and 06:00. The main lobby is locked after 21:30, so enter via the side door on the courtyard. The lifts are switched to card-only mode overnight, and the kitchen on two stays open. Log your arrival in the night book at the security desk. The side-door code is below.

staff pass of yageg-fafog = bdg-A-76

Subject: Handover — relevance tuning notes

On-call: handing off the Thornquist search cluster. Synonym weights were retuned Tuesday; recall improved but the scoring job now runs hot around midnight. If latency pages fire, check the boost-recalc queue before anything else. Tuning notes and per-field weight history are in the relevance_audit table. Don't edit weights live; stage them first. To reach the tuning database, use the connection string below.

primary connection of yagep-kahip = redis://giliel_svc:zYiKsLL2PLpfPL@db-348f.xolmarsys.corp:5432/fenwyn